Why does a cat's hair tangle into clumps? 1. Lack of daily care: Cats' hair is prone to tangling, often because the owner does not comb the cat's hair regularly. Ignoring the maintenance of the hair causes the hair to get tangled. Especially after the cat's hair gets wet, if it is not wiped dry in time, the moisture will cause the hair to stick together and form clumps. 2. Malnutrition: A cat’s coarse and tangled fur may also be caused by improper diet. If a cat’s diet lacks necessary nutrients, such as vitamins and protein, it may affect the health of the fur, causing it to lose its luster and become dry, making it more prone to tangling. 3. Improper bathing methods: Using bathing products that are not suitable for cats may also cause hair problems. Shower gels used by humans may be harmful to cats' skin and hair. Long-term use may damage the hair, making it rough and prone to clumping. How to solve the problem of cat hair tangling? 1. Combing hair: When you find that the cat's hair is tangled and there is hair loss, you should first use a comb designed for pets to comb the hair to remove dead hair and reduce clumps. Be gentle during the combing process to avoid hurting the cat's skin. 2. Nutritional supplement: If the tangles are caused by malnutrition, the necessary nutrients should be supplemented by adjusting the cat's diet. You can increase the intake of foods such as chicken, lamb, beef, egg yolks and fish rich in omega-3 fatty acids. At the same time, you can add lecithin to the cat's food to help the healthy growth of hair. 3. Proper maintenance: Regular bathing can help remove dirt from your cat's fur, keep it clean, and reduce the possibility of clumping. But you should use a shower gel designed specifically for cats and avoid using human bath products. |
